I see a lot of discussion on this forum and also on our Dutch forums.
There are Pro's and Con's to having or not having restrictions.
But, there is a simple solution, and the beauty of the solution is: it already has been done by Polyphony!

In the beginning of SE2, the restrictions were there.
Then when SE3 was introduced, the restrictions on SE2 were lifted.
Why not do this for all foollowing events?

My suggestion:
So, SE5 will start with restrictions so the die hard gamers can have their fun, keep it in for like 2 weeks till SE6 starts, then lift the restrictions so everyone can have the possibility to get the creds and the xp.

Best for everyone I think?

I think they should just limit the cars to highest HP and lowest KGS of the "typical opponents" list your racing against (with tire restrictions). This way you have some wiggle room but can not build a monster for an easy win.

Personally I just limit myself, adding power or different tires if I can't get the win. As long as you slowly do the mods you'll find the right balance for your skill level. For example the C4 WRC on Rome, I could only get 3rd with supplied tires so I went up one level for the win.

The previous system wasn't fair because everyone has different skill levels. For example I could do no better then 6th in NASCAR 'ring mess but with different tires I pulled off the victory. I'm not some horrible driver (half of my licenses are gold, the other half silver) but I'm not great either so I need some help. I'd prefer to mod the car slightly then switch to using the SRF "cheat".
